Present: Harrow, Vex, Delmonte. Prepared for incoming director T. Abrell.

1. Reseller tiers approved: Bronze, Silver, Gold. Margins set per the Quillon schedule.
2. Onboarding backlog: 14 applicants pending; Vex to clear by month end.
3. Certification course for the Ardent platform ships next quarter.
4. Disputes process with Farlane Trading resolved; no escalation needed.
5. Territory overlap in the Coraline district deferred.

The incoming director should read the following before the kickoff.

confidential, yajof-fadug: Project Julvan slips by one quarter because of the audit delay.

## Tuning

Shrinkwrap, our batch image-resizing CLI, scales throughput with worker count and tile buffer size, but both trade directly against peak memory. Support: if a customer reports out-of-memory aborts on large TIFF batches, lower concurrency before touching buffer sizes, since buffers are shared across workers. The defaults were benchmarked on an 8-core reference box with 16 GB of RAM. The shipped constants are listed below.

tuning table, yajog-yahof:
BUDGETS = {
    "lamvan": 303,
    "wenox": 460,
    "fenvan": 525,
}

Quarterly Planning Note — Warranty Overrun

Team, the warranty bucket for the Ashfold R-Series blew past forecast again this quarter — claims from the coastal branches are the main driver. We're tightening the inspection step at the Varnley plant and expect numbers to settle by Q2. Plan your budgets assuming the higher run rate for now. Context worth keeping to this group:

board note of kageg-bahof: The renewal with Holwynax Holdings closes at $2 million a year, 5 percent below the last contract. Project Ulaath slips by two quarters because of the supplier delay.

Ticket: Staging env misconfigured for Siftgate bloom filter

The bloom layer in front of the Pellet KV store is rejecting all lookups in staging because the env file was copied from the dev template without credentials. False-positive tuning values are fine; only the auth line is missing. To unblock the weekly demo, the Pellet admission secret must be set on the following line.

env line for yaguf-fajop: LEDGER_TOKEN13=fb08984397349